Lucas Oil 10679 Hot Rod & Classic Car SAE 10W-30

Lucas Oil 10679 SAE 10W-30 motor oil targets classic and hot-rod petrol engines with a focus on impact protection. It uses high-quality paraffinic base oils and a protective additive package rich in zinc, molybdenum, and phosphorus to create a tougher film for engine protection. The 10W-30 viscosity supports reliability across varying climates and driving conditions, helping engines that require good cold-flow characteristics while maintaining protection at higher temperatures. This oil is commonly favored for classic vehicles and engines that demand robust anti-wear performance in everyday street use.

Buying Guide: Key Purchase Considerations
- Engine type and oil specification: Always verify the oil’s viscosity, certification (API SP, SN/CF), and compatibility with your engine. Petrol engines typically benefit from 5W-30 or 5W-40 in modern vehicles, while older engines or specific climates may perform better with a different grade.
- Synthetic vs. conventional: Full synthetic oils provide superior protection, better thermal stability, and longer life. Blends offer a balance of protection and cost. Choose based on driving conditions, climate, and manufacturer recommendations.
- Viscosity and climate: In cold climates, choose lower cold-start viscosity (e.g., 0W-20 to 5W-30). In hot climates or high-load driving, higher viscosity (like 40) may help maintain film strength.
- Wear protection and additives: Some products include ceramic additives or zinc/phosphorus packages for anti-wear protection. Additives can complement the base oil, but ensure compatibility with your engine and filters.
- Oil capacity and change intervals: Check your vehicle’s oil capacity and the manufacturer’s recommended intervals. Larger containers (5 quarts or more) are convenient for standard oil changes.
- Filter compatibility: Some products emphasize compatibility with common oil filters. If you use a particular filter brand, confirm compatibility with the additive or oil choice.
- Special use cases: Classic cars, racing, or high-mileage vehicles may benefit from specific formulations or high-zinc content. For these cases, consult vehicle-specific guides or a qualified technician.
- Cost and availability: While premium synthetic oils can cost more upfront, they often reduce overall maintenance costs through better protection and fewer oil changes. Consider long-term value and local availability.
